Google Analytics is Google's audience measurement tool, in its GA4 (Google Analytics 4) version. It tracks visits, journeys and conversions for a website or mobile app, using an event-based model rather than page views.
GA4 is used to understand where traffic comes from, what visitors do, which pages and campaigns convert, and to tie that data to Google Ads and Search Console. It provides reports, audiences and free-form data exploration. It is the most widespread measurement layer on the web, free for the vast majority of sites.
GA4 is powerful and free, but its use raises GDPR questions about data transfers. European alternatives exist for teams wanting EU hosting and a cookieless model. For rankings and SEO tracking, it pairs with Google Search Console.
GA4 is free, with collection limits ample for most sites. Very high volumes move to Analytics 360, the enterprise version billed on quote (typically tens of thousands of euros a year), which lifts quotas and adds SLAs.
